Output 820da30645d18062ae3fa9d0d829e14bcbf3c5797ec887b971fe1a34c71d3759:1

value
496435771
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e07ad36c2f4b9347fb186c34db575586c40d73e OP_EQUAL
address
3DBQG6U66fHjkoxfkns5ZvELXUAyhidzzk
transaction
820da30645d18062ae3fa9d0d829e14bcbf3c5797ec887b971fe1a34c71d3759
spent
true